WebFeb 2, 2016 · Integration is indeed an obligatory step of retroviral replication in which the viral RNA genome is first converted to double-stranded DNA by the virus-encoded reverse transcriptase, then travels across the cell cytoplasm to enter the nucleus, and is finally incorporated into the host cell genome. cstb atex https://youin-ele.com

WebGene integration into the host genome is known to occur either randomly or in a targeted manner as a result of homologous recombination. The latter approach offers the advantage of introducing or deleting specific DNA sequences from defined chromosomal locations. Web3.1.1.1 Genomic integration. One strategy adopted to increase the efficiency of homologous recombination, is the addition of endonucleases for the DNA integration process, which generates double-strand breaks within the target chromosome, facilitating genome integration. WebJun 18, 2024 · The integration of HBV genomic DNA into the host genome occurs randomly, early after infection, and is associated with hepatocarcinogenesis in HBV-infected patients. Therefore, it is important to analyze HBV genome integration.
